Output 4752e604348999d8091ec23f1aec273bec717e541269f165c7bc73867071159d:3

value
43341540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15eba3c9f1dc2d436a1a7eead3109867c2aa726b OP_EQUAL
address
M9u4hztoMrZgFKUYwfBWm2mZPDd65MWuQP
transaction
4752e604348999d8091ec23f1aec273bec717e541269f165c7bc73867071159d
spent
true